Importantly, all pieces created at Lavender Art Studios are drawn and rendered entirely in a freehand style. We do not use graphing methods, grids, or external props. Greg Devenny-Mackay personally trains all students in regular term classes and student teachers for shp in freehand drawing techniques, which include the drafting of underdrawings beneath paintings. This builds strong observational skills and encourages authentic artistic development from the first sketch to the final artwork.
